Abstract

Envy (Hasad) is a psychological illness with significant psychological, moral, and social impacts. It is a spiritual disease that can lead to various forms of evil, such as slander, ridicule, humiliation, and persecution. This study examines the problematics of hasad from the perspective of the Qur'an using the Tafsir Maqashidi approach, a method of interpretation that emphasizes the objectives and wisdom (maqashid) behind Islamic teachings. The Qur'an highlights the roots, manifestations, and impacts of hasad, while also providing spiritual guidance for overcoming and preventing it. The central issues addressed in this research are: What forms of problematics arise from hasad in life according to the Qur'anic perspective? How does the concept of Maqashid Asy-Syari'ah in Qur'anic verses about hasad relate to the issues caused by it? The objectives of this research are to identify and analyze the various forms of problematics caused by hasad in daily life based on the Qur'anic perspective. Furthermore, the study aims to explain the concept of Maqashid Asy-Syari'ah in Qur'anic verses related to hasad and how this concept provides solutions to the issues arising from it. Additionally, the research seeks to reveal the relevance of the Qur'anic teachings in addressing the negative impacts of hasad, both at the individual and social levels.
